Mocking Jays
The Mocking Jays are, Jacob, Lewis, Sam & Alex, a young, vibrant, enthusiastic and extraordinarily talented band who are delighting audiences throughout the UK. Their sound is tight, funky and Indie style with songs written by themselves which will be featured on the release of their forthcoming EP
Their sound varies from catchy, poppy hooks that stick in your head for days, to surging, powerful grooves that make you move your feet.
The band have been booked for some great gigs over the summer including council events, riverside festivals, beer festivals and major pop festivals around the country including getting the winning public vote to appear at this years Y Not? Festival. For 2017 they have already been booked to appear at The Rock & Bike Festival
National and local radio have featured the band in interviews and live music sessions and with a busy schedule of live gigs they can be seen at a venue near you soon.

Her Berden
Her Burden are a pop-rock four piece born and raised in Leicestershire, UK. Fronted by Joshua Jones, the band began with himself alone going on to create a full length album of diverse tracks (in which the multi-talented Joshua played every instrument and handled every element of production). Joshua was later joined by Luke Spencer (Guitar), Matthew White (Bass) and Matthew Newton (Drums). Inspired by old-school pop-punk legends Green Day and Sum41, they also take influence from the likes of The Rolling Stones and Daft Punk. Creatively combining the raw energy and honesty of punk rock with the memorable hooks associated with mainstream pop. However, they do not see themselves as your stereotypical pop-punk band as the diverse range of musical interest within the band has led to the creation of an alternative pop-rock sound.

As a trio (before Mathew Newton was introduced) they spent 2015 writing, recording and performing live acoustically. During this time they released their first single 'Psychopath' along with a music video, independently filmed and released by themselves and close friends. During the summer of 2015 Her Burden devoted a great deal of time and energy into recording their first E.P as a full band titled 'Lately', released January 2016. Since the release of 'Lately' the new boys on the Leicester music scene have been busy trying to build a reputation with the hard work they put into their live shows and in the studio. This release has also lead to another self made music video to accompany the title track as well as 'On Your Own' being featured on BBC Introducing.

Her Burden are currently working hard both on and off the stage, perfecting every aspect of their music and performance. In just one year they have already come along way since the backroom sessions at Luke's house and show no intentions of slowing down.
